Skip to content

Latest commit

 

History

History
217 lines (119 loc) · 4.77 KB

directmarketing-phonenumber.schema.md

File metadata and controls

217 lines (119 loc) · 4.77 KB

Direct marketing phone number Schema

https://ns.adobe.com/xdm/context/directmarketing-phonenumber

Phone number used to contact a user.

Abstract Extensible Status Identifiable Custom Properties Additional Properties Defined In
Can be instantiated Yes Experimental No Forbidden Permitted context/directmarketing-phonenumber.schema.json

Schema Hierarchy

  • Direct marketing phone number https://ns.adobe.com/xdm/context/directmarketing-phonenumber

Direct marketing phone number Example

{
  "xdm:primary": true,
  "xdm:number": "1-408-888-8888",
  "xdm:status": "active",
  "xdm:errorCount": 0
}

Direct marketing phone number Properties

Property Type Required Default Defined by
xdm:errorCount integer Optional Direct marketing phone number (this schema)
xdm:extension string Optional Phone number
xdm:number string Optional Phone number
xdm:primary boolean Optional Phone number
xdm:quality string Optional Direct marketing phone number (this schema)
xdm:status string Optional "active" Phone number
xdm:statusReason string Optional Phone number
xdm:validity string Optional Phone number
* any Additional this schema allows additional properties

xdm:errorCount

Error count

Number of consecutive errors when calling this phone number.

xdm:errorCount

  • is optional
  • type: integer
  • defined in this schema

xdm:errorCount Type

integer

xdm:extension

Extension

The internal dialing number used to call from a private exchange, operator, or switchboard.

xdm:extension

xdm:extension Type

string

xdm:number

Number

The phone number. Note the phone number is a string and may include meaningful characters such as brackets '()', hyphens '-', or characters to indicate sub-dialing identifiers like extensions 'x' for example, 1-353(0)18391111 or +613 9403600x1234.

xdm:number

xdm:number Type

string

xdm:primary

Primary

Primary phone number indicator. Unlike address or email address, there can be multiple primary phone numbers; one per communication channel. The communication channel is defined by the type: textMessaging, mobile, phone, home, work, unknown, and fax.

xdm:primary

xdm:primary Type

boolean

xdm:quality

Quality

Quality rating.

xdm:quality

  • is optional
  • type: string
  • defined in this schema

xdm:quality Type

string

xdm:status

Status

An indication as to the ability to use the phone number.

xdm:status

  • is optional
  • type: string
  • default: "active"
  • defined in Phone number

xdm:status Type

string

xdm:status Known Values

Value Description
active Active
incomplete Incomplete
blacklisted Blacklisted
blocked Blocked

xdm:statusReason

Status reason

A description of the current status.

xdm:statusReason

xdm:statusReason Type

string

xdm:validity

Validity

A level of technical correctness of the phone number.

xdm:validity

xdm:validity Type

string

xdm:validity Known Values

Value Description
consistent Consistent
inconsistent Inconsistent
incomplete Incomplete
successfullyUsed Successfully used